Purpose

Provide reporting, document preparation, and administrative support services to the Right of Way project team. Track projects, research online records, enter data, create documents, record information and manage records, manage schedules, provide project management support, and perform other related administrative functions.

Responsibilities
Leadership and Direction
  • Perform work under moderate supervision. Receive direction on moderately complex assignments, tasks, and execution. Work is frequently reviewed by more senior staff to ensure application of sound techniques and principles. Review work produced by junior staff for quality assurance.
At the Operational and Company Level
  • From time-to-time, act as the liaison between ROW teams and other Bowman departments or outside stakeholders – suppliers, accounting, human resources, etc.
  • Prepare weekly reports relating to departmental projects and activities for PM and Client.
  • Utilize client systems to create required correspondence and locate contact/other pertinent information for customers.
Do the Work
  • Assist Right of Way Agents and Project Managers in preparing documents (i.e., Easements, Letters, Proposals, Work Orders, Change Orders, Sub Consultant Agreements, Transmittals) and processing same in workflow system.
  • Initial entry and daily update of project and parcel information in database and project tracking reports.
  • Research property records and download deeds, easements, judgments, liens, assessment cards, plats, and maps from online county resources.
  • Use online resources to determine status of corporations and officer’s/agents, as well as researching contact information for parcel owners.
  • Utilize mail merge to generate mass mailing documents and correspondence. Print documents and prepare packages for mailing.
  • Organize and maintain electronic and paper data filing systems; upload and file required documents.
  • Accompany right-of-way agents in field for purposes of witness/notary of documents.
  • Compose and edit correspondence in Word. Create and maintain spreadsheets in Excel.
  • Train/mentor entry level Right-of Way Technicians in Bowman processes and procedures.
